Output 7531c4eaddd77d894c26c968065736a5cb66c6fabc05ff50e516805979687574:1

value
1390000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 92d65104a9f4ed5b3f04709ac8dd52de9820e699 OP_EQUALVERIFY OP_CHECKSIG
address
1EPQPyg8N7aYHZE5qp8RSgSWpzveUcm44T
transaction
7531c4eaddd77d894c26c968065736a5cb66c6fabc05ff50e516805979687574
spent
true